Vegetable pan deluxe

Ingredients for 4 servings:

  • 200 g broccoli, cut into small florets
  • ½ kohlrabi, cut into strips.
  • 180 g carrot(s), sliced
  • 150 g peas, young
  • 100 g Brussels sprouts
  • 2 stalk(s) celery, sliced
  • 2 garlic cloves
  • Cayenne pepper
  • salt and pepper
  • 2 tbsp oil

Instructions

Working time approx. 20 minutes; Total time approx. 20 minutes

Wash, trim, and prepare the vegetables. Then add the carrots and Brussels sprouts to a large pot of boiling salted water. After 5 minutes of cooking, add the broccoli, kohlrabi, peas, and celery and cook for another 5 minutes. Drain the vegetables, rinse with cold water, and let them drain well. Pour the oil into a pan and briefly fry the vegetables. Now add the finely chopped garlic cloves and fry briefly. Season with salt, pepper, and cayenne pepper and serve. I like to serve this vegetable stir-fry with fish, such as cod or salmon fillet. Of course, you can vary the vegetables.
